beg3yrs Posted May 17, 2016 #37 Share Posted May 17, 2016 (edited) What happened to the previous CD? Looks like he was only on the Emerald for a month...is it SOP for Princess to replace CD on a monthly basis? It's not a policy that they get replaced on a monthly basis. Subjectively it seems the CDs typically stick around anywhere from three to six months. They may take a month break and return to the same ship or get assigned to another one. I know of one CD who considers himself primarily a "fill-in" CD, showing up when another CD departs unexpectedly.
